BOARDMAN There will be services at 11 a.m. Thursday at the Higgins-Reardon Funeral Home, Boardman-Canfield Chapel, for Pauline M. Weimer, 89, who
passed away Monday afternoon at Forum Health Northside Medical Center.
Mrs. Weimer was born May 23, 1917 in Youngstown, the daughter of Stewart and Emma Engster Ritter, and was a lifelong area resident.
She attended The Rayen School, was a homemaker and also a member of the Austintown Community Church.
Pauline¹s mother died shortly after her birth and she was raised by her stepmother, Susan Duffy Ritter.
Her husband, William Weimer, whom she married Jan. 27, 1937, died April, 21 2004.
She leaves a daughter, Shirley Bob Beckwith of Austintown; a son, William Lillian Weimer of Youngstown; three sisters, Gladys Bucsar of Boardman, Helen Ted Nogay of Hermitage, Pa., and Dorothy Fox of Youngstown; a brother, William Louise Ritter of Canfield; four grandchildren, Robert Rosemary Beckwith of Austintown, Lori Acevedo of Tarpon Springs, Fla., Dr. David Shannon Weimer of Detroit and Dr. Daniel Georga Weimer of San Antonio, Texas; and five great-grandchildren, Paul and Kyle Acevedo, Bobby Beckwith and Luke and Grace Weimer. Her greatest pride and joy were her grandchildren and her great-grandchildren.
Besides her husband, she was preceded in death by her parents and two brothers, Thomas and Paul Ritter.
